Characterizations of graphs with given inertia index achieving the maximum diameter

ABSTRACT

The positive (resp., negative) inertia index of a graph G, denoted by p(G) (resp., n(G)), is defined to be the number of positive (resp., negative) eigenvalues of its adjacency matrix. A simple result shows that 1d(G)2p(G) and 1d(G)2n(G), where d(G) is the diameter of G. In this paper we determine the sufficient and necessary conditions when each of the equalities holds.
